  • Abstract
    Many techniques, such as parameter extraction techniques are used in ultrasonic signal processing. In this paper, the matching pursuit decomposition (MP) and differential evolution (DE) have been tested for parameters estimation, denoising and compression of ultrasonic echoes. The method is based on the MP algorithm who does the decomposition of the ultrasonic signal into elementary functions (atoms) which they make a good representation of this signal. Those elementary functions are selected from a Gabor dictionary and their parameters are estimated by differential evolution.
